Yes we did ask for his signature but even though McCarthy approved of our edition, he did not want to sign and we had to respect his wishes. There was no further information provided, however it makes sense knowing what we know about the personal nature of the story and the signed copies for his son. For Paul, even though he would have liked for it to be signed, he felt so strongly about the novel and that it really deserved a special limited edition treatment.
